    Fisetin: A Potent Antioxidant for Health and Longevity
    Fisetin, a naturally occurring flavonoid found in various fruits and vegetables such as strawberries, apples, and onions, is gaining attention for its remarkable health benefits. Known for its potent ant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and senolytic properties, fisetin is being studied for its potential to support longevity and mitigate age-related diseases.
    Major Components of Fisetin
    Fisetin itself is the active flavonoid component responsible for the various health benefits. It is chemically known as 3,3',4',7-tetrahydroxyflavone. Its molecular structure allows it to interact with different biological pathways, leading to its diverse therapeutic effects.
    Applications in Dietary Supplements
    Fisetin is commonly used in dietary supplements aimed at supporting brain health, reducing inflammation, and promoting longevity. The recommended dosage varies, but it typically ranges from 100 to 500 mg per day, depending on the specific formulation and intended use.
